CONTRARY TO SOME belief, Joe's
Crab Shack on Maple, east of Orchard
Lake Road, in West Bloomfield, is in no
way connected with Florida's legendary
Joe's Stone Crab ... In fact, Joe's Stone
Crab seems to have more little shrimp
dishes than it does crab ... The food is
fair, but the place is a lot of fun for
youngsters.

THIRTY YEARS AGO, she wanted
to call her first gift shop A Touch of
Glass, but discovered that a store across
the street was already using it ... So a dis-
appointed Judye Koploy shook her head
and named it after the Franklin house in
which she opened her little 420-square-
foot gift shop.
It was a more than 100-year-old home
(1867) that had been named for the
people who lived there and in the back
made the first Franklin Dry Roasted
peanuts so popular today.
Slade's Gift Shop was there five years,
went to Applegate Square in Southfield
... and is now celebrating its 30-year
anniversary ... in a new 5,000-square-
foot locale, across from Tapper's in
Orchard Lake Mall, Orchard Lake Road
and Maple, West Bloomfield.

QUESTION & ANSWER DEPT ...
Q. "In your column, you mentioned

about Sonny Eliot telling a story about
Ivan Boesky being the son of Sam
Boesky. Didn't you mean Bill Boesky?
Sam was Ivan's uncle. My dad, William
Kaufman, owned Kaufman Restaurant
Supply and put in the entire Brass Rail."
... Patty Kaufman O'Connor.
A. How could I have missed that,
Patty ... I sure remember Ivan working
for his dad, Bill Boesky, as his manager
of the Brass Rail on Adams in Detroit ...
Sam and Bill were brothers ... By the
way, Patty, your dad was one of the
